Any way onto my review. I'm not sticking to the comp rules so na na.

 

I chose the Cherry Glaze.....

 

Firstly for perspective when it comes to cleaning cars I don't mind spending time doing it but the easier the better.

 

Method used.......... Cleaned car 2 bucket method. Cleaned the whole car with Autoglym tar remover (to remove any previous wax). Applied Cherry Glaze to the whole car in one go by hand. Had a smoke break. polished Cherry Glaze off by hand.

Approx temp 22 degrees c, Bright sunshine.

 

Application...............................Very easy on

Removal...................................Very easy off

Residue.....................................None

Plastic/Rubber friendly...............Yes

Going to use my samples for the first time this week. Has anyone used the shampoo in a AB HD Snowfoam lance yet? and how much did you use in the bottom, 1 inch ok?

Another PM sent your way Sparkly............

Did mine last weekend. Used just over half the 100ml bottle (came to about 1/2 inch in the lance bottle) and the foam was fine. Certainly dwelt as long on the car, if not a little longer, than 1 inch of the BH foam I normally use.

 

I used most of the remainder of the sample instead of my usual Valet Pro Poseidon shampoo.

 

Car hadn't been done for three weeks (!) and the Mr Pink appeared to have done a slightly better job than the BH foam does. Certainly seemed to do a better job loosening insect roadkill off the front of the car. 

 

I couldn't say which does a better job between Mr Pink & Poseidon as a shampoo, though, as both do a great job.
